        • Trivia
          USSR's Minister of Art & Culture, Romanov, forbade Innokentiy Smoktunovskiy to play the part of Detochkin because a couple of years before Smoktunovsky had played Vladimir Lenin. And, according to Romanov, Smoktunovsky could not play someone who steals cars; in fact, he thought that a man, who once played Lenin, could not play in movies any longer. But, luckily, Romanov retired in the same month his statement was made and a new minister allowed Innokenti to continue his work.

        Many Volga cars, very interesting scenes of Russian life in 1966
        I just watched this movie online for free. I love old cars and have never been to Europe, let alone Russia so I jumped at the chance to see the old Volgas when new (nearly every car in sight) and the scenes of everyday life in a Russian city back then. No Volgas in Australia that I know of.

        Movie contrasts the corruption in daily life at the time, with a local volunteer acting/playhouse project where the playhouse boss says the best actors are the ones that have another job (not professional actors).

        The main character is employed in insurance sales (an industry that is virtually the worlds biggest corruption industry), he is funny because he is quite inept and comical, but keeps committing the car stealing crimes in an attempt to level the playing field of life in the community. His family are very confused by his actions.

        I enjoyed the movie very much.
